What is the minimum liquid seal height required for fixture traps?

The minimum liquid seal height required for fixture traps is 2 inches. This measurement is crucial because the trap's primary function is to create a barrier of water that prevents sewage gases from entering the living space. A liquid seal of at least 2 inches ensures that there is enough water to provide an effective seal against these gases under varying conditions, such as evaporation or airflow that could disturb the seal. Additionally, the 2-inch height helps accommodate potential pressure changes in the drainage system and ensures that the trap can maintain its function in properly sealing against odor and gas infiltration. This standard helps maintain a safe and sanitary environment within plumbing systems.
